首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据追加两次只需调用单个事件

是指在云计算领域中,通过调用一个事件即可实现数据的追加操作两次。这种方式可以提高数据追加的效率和简化开发过程。

数据追加是指在已有数据的基础上,将新的数据添加到数据集中。在云计算中,数据追加通常用于日志记录、数据采集、实时数据处理等场景。

优势:

  1. 高效性:通过调用单个事件实现数据追加,可以减少网络通信和系统开销,提高数据追加的效率。
  2. 简化开发:使用单个事件进行数据追加可以简化开发过程,减少代码量和维护成本。

应用场景:

  1. 日志记录:在系统运行过程中,将关键操作、错误信息等记录到日志文件中,方便后续排查问题和分析系统性能。
  2. 数据采集:在物联网、传感器等设备中,通过追加数据的方式实时采集环境数据、用户行为等信息。
  3. 实时数据处理:在实时数据处理场景中,通过追加数据的方式实时更新数据集,如实时推荐系统、实时监控等。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云日志服务(CLS):提供日志采集、存储、检索和分析的全套解决方案,支持海量日志数据的实时处理和分析。详细信息请参考:腾讯云日志服务
  • 腾讯云物联网平台(IoT Hub):提供设备连接管理、数据采集、消息通信等功能,支持海量设备的数据追加和实时处理。详细信息请参考:腾讯云物联网平台
  • 腾讯云流计算(TencentDB for TDSQL):提供实时数据处理和分析的云数据库服务,支持数据追加和实时计算。详细信息请参考:腾讯云流计算
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云存储服务,支持数据的追加和存储。详细信息请参考:腾讯云对象存储
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Flink进阶-Flink CEP(复杂事件处理)

5万人关注的大数据成神之路,不来了解一下吗? 5万人关注的大数据成神之路,真的不来了解一下吗? 5万人关注的大数据成神之路,确定真的不来了解一下吗? 欢迎您关注《大数据成神之路》 0....本文概述简介 FlinkCEP是在Flink之上实现的复杂事件处理(CEP)库。 它允许你在×××的事件流中检测事件模式,让你有机会掌握数据中重要的事项。...单个模式接受单个事件,而循环模式可以接受多个事件。在模式匹配符号中,模式“a b + c?d”(或“a”,后跟一个或多个“b”,可选地后跟“c”,后跟“d”),a,c ?...要指定要使用的跳过策略,只需调用以下命令创建AfterMatchSkipStrategy: ? 使用方法: AfterMatchSkipStrategy skipStrategy = ......为了对这些超时的部分匹配作出相应的处理,select和flatSelect API调用允许指定超时处理程序。 为每个超时的部分事件序列调用此超时处理程序。

15.6K33
  • Flink进阶-Flink CEP(复杂事件处理)

    本文概述简介 FlinkCEP是在Flink之上实现的复杂事件处理(CEP)库。 它允许你在×××的事件流中检测事件模式,让你有机会掌握数据中重要的事项。...单个模式接受单个事件,而循环模式可以接受多个事件。在模式匹配符号中,模式“a b + c?d”(或“a”,后跟一个或多个“b”,可选地后跟“c”,后跟“d”),a,c ?...要指定要使用的跳过策略,只需调用以下命令创建AfterMatchSkipStrategy: ? 使用方法: AfterMatchSkipStrategy skipStrategy = ......PatternSelectFunction具有为每个匹配事件序列调用的select方法。...为了对这些超时的部分匹配作出相应的处理,select和flatSelect API调用允许指定超时处理程序。 为每个超时的部分事件序列调用此超时处理程序。

    1.3K20

    【IOC 控制反转】Android 事件依赖注入 ( 事件依赖注入具体的操作细节 | 创建 事件监听器 对应的 动态代理 | 动态代理的数据准备 | 创建调用处理程序 | 创建动态代理实例对象 )

    文章目 前言 一、创建 事件监听器 对应的 动态代理 二、动态代理 数据准备 三、动态代理 调用处理程序 四、动态代理 实例对象创建 前言 Android 依赖注入的核心就是通过反射获取 类 / 方法.../ 字段 上的注解 , 以及注解属性 ; 在 Activity 基类中 , 获取该注解 以及 注解属性 , 进行相关操作 ; 在博客 【IOC 控制反转】Android 事件依赖注入 ( 事件三要素 |...修饰注解的注解 | 事件依赖注入步骤 ) 中 , 定义了 2 个注解 , 第一个是方法上的注解 , 用于修饰方法 ; 第二个是修饰注解的注解 , 该注解用于配置注入的方法 ( 事件监听方法 | 监听器类型...| 监听器回调方法 ) ; 事件依赖注入比较复杂 , 涉及到动态代理 , 本博客分析 【IOC 控制反转】Android 事件依赖注入 ( 事件依赖注入代码示例 ) 事件依赖注入的详细步骤 ; 本博客的核心是...; 二、动态代理 数据准备 ---- 执行动态代理前 , 首先要知道拦截接口方法 , 以及要注入的方法 ; 拦截到接口方法后 , 替换成自己注入的方法 , 就是调用自己的方法 ; 将二者封装到 Map

    2.4K10

    带你实现一个简单的多边形编辑器

    { if (this.isClosePath) { return } // ... } } 需要注意的是dbClick事件触发的时候也同时会触发两次...click事件,这样就导致最后双击的位置也被添加进去了,而且添加了两次,可以手动把最后两个点去掉或者自己使用click事件来模拟双击事件,本文方便起见就不处理了。...checkPointIndex (x, y) { let result = -1 // 遍历顶点绘制圆形路径,和上面的绘制顶点圆形的区别是这里不需要实际描边和填充,只需要路径...,先判断鼠标按下时是否在多边形内,然后在移动过程中更新所有顶点的位置,和拖动单个的区别是记录和应用的是移动的偏移量,这就需要先缓存一下鼠标按下的位置和此刻的顶点数据。...另外除了吸附到顶点,还需要吸附到线段,也就是线段上离当前点最近的一个点上,也以拖动单个顶点为例来看一下。

    1.2K40

    TiKV 高性能追踪的实现解析

    指标:记录和呈现可聚合的数据。 追踪:单个请求的一系列事件。...计时 计时在追踪中是高频操作,每个 Span 都需要取两次时间戳,分别代表事件的起始和结束时刻,因此计时的性能会很大程度上影响追踪的性能。...Rust 社区也提供了库 coarsetime 获取 Coarse Time: coarsetime::Instant::now() Coarse Time 性能很高,在测试环境下完成两次调用仅需要 10ns...在追踪中,完整的计时操作会读取两次时间戳,分别代表事件的始末。由于操作系统的线程调度,这两个时间戳的读取可能发生在不同的核心上。...通过上述方式为单个函数记录的执行信息如下: 调用的发生时刻 调用的返回时刻 直接(或间接)调用者的引用 直接(或间接)调用的子函数的引用 例如,追踪两个同步函数 foo 和 bar,通过添加 trace

    59310

    Redis AOF 持久化详解

    文件写入和同步 Redis 每次结束一个事件循环之前,它都会调用 flushAppendOnlyFile 函数,判断是否需要将 AOF 缓存区中的内容写入和同步到 AOF 文件中。...当发生故障停机时,AOF 持久化也只会丢失一个事件循环中所产生的命令数据。...同步文件之前,如果此时系统故障宕机,缓冲区内数据将丢失。 而 fsync 针对单个文件操作,对其进行强制硬盘同步, fsync 将阻塞直到写入磁盘完成后返回,保证了数据持久化。...appendfsync的三个值代表着三种不同的调用 fsync的策略。调用 fsync周期越频繁,读写效率就越差,但是相应的安全性越高,发生宕机时丢失的数据越少。...如上图所示,重写前要记录名为 list的键的状态,AOF 文件要保存五条命令,而重写后,则只需要保存一条命令。

    42310

    RocketMQ 整合 DLedger(多副本)即主从切换实现平滑升级的设计技巧

    文件的单个文件大小一致。...3.4 recover 在 Broker 启动时会加载 commitlog、consumequeue等文件,需要恢复其相关是数据结构,特别是与写入、刷盘、提交等指针,其具体调用 recover 方法。...,则只需要恢复 DLedger 相关数据文件,因为在加载旧的 commitlog 文件时已经将其重要的数据指针设置为最大值。...,则不再写入到原先的 commitlog 文件中,而是调用 DLedgerServer 的 handleAppend 进行消息追加,该方法会有集群内的 Leader 节点负责消息追加以及在消息复制,只有超过集群内的半数节点成功写入消息后...消息追加到 DLedger 数据日志文件中,返回的偏移量不是 DLedger 条目的起始偏移量,而是DLedger 条目中 body 字段的起始偏移量,即真实消息的起始偏移量,保证消息物理偏移量的语义与

    1.1K30

    快速入门Flink (10) —— DataStream API 开发之【EventTime 与 Window】

    ,那么需要引入 EventTime 的时间属性,引入方式如下所示: val env = StreamExecutionEnvironment.getExecutionEnvironment // 从调用时刻开始给...2.2.1 基本概念 我们知道,流处理从事件产生,到流经 source,再到 operator,中间是有一个过程和 时间的,虽然大部分情况下,流到 operator 的数据都是按照事件产生的时间顺序来的...就会一直被加入到 Window 中,直到 Window 被触发才会停止数据追加,而当 Window 触发之后才接受到的属于被触发 Window 的数据会被丢弃。...result.print() // 9、执行程序 senv.execute("SlidingEventTimeWindowsDemo") } } 2.3.3 会话窗口 相邻两次数据的.../* * @Author: Alice菌 * @Date: 2020/10/24 20:58 * @Description: 会话窗口 相邻两次数据的 EventTime 的时间差超过指定的时间间隔就会触发执行

    68610

    Redis AOF 持久化详解

    文件写入和同步 Redis 每次结束一个事件循环之前,它都会调用 flushAppendOnlyFile 函数,判断是否需要将 AOF 缓存区中的内容写入和同步到 AOF 文件中。...当发生故障停机时,AOF 持久化也只会丢失一个事件循环中所产生的命令数据。...同步文件之前,如果此时系统故障宕机,缓冲区内数据将丢失。 而 fsync 针对单个文件操作,对其进行强制硬盘同步, fsync 将阻塞直到写入磁盘完成后返回,保证了数据持久化。...appendfsync的三个值代表着三种不同的调用 fsync的策略。调用 fsync周期越频繁,读写效率就越差,但是相应的安全性越高,发生宕机时丢失的数据越少。...如上图所示,重写前要记录名为 list的键的状态,AOF 文件要保存五条命令,而重写后,则只需要保存一条命令。

    72230

    kafka篇-设计思路

    kafka构建了一种新颖的消息系统,提供了类似于消息传递系统的API,允许应用程序实时的订阅日志事件,做到实时或近实时分析。 2....为了充分利用磁盘顺序读写能力、实现消息存储时的高吞吐,kafka只是对消息进行简单的读取和追加,并没有使用类似于BTree的数据结构来索引数据和随机读写数据。...为了避免过多的字节拷贝,kafka对日志块的网络传输也进行了优化,通过sendfile系统调用数据从page cache直接转移到socket网络连接中。...(内核空间) 操作系统将数据从套接字缓冲区(内核空间) -> 网络发送的 NIC 缓冲区 中间涉及4次copy操作和两次系统调用,而通过sendfile的话,可以允许操作系统将数据从page cache...直接发送到网络,即只需最后一步操作,可将数据复制到NIC缓冲区。

    72220

    TiKV 高性能追踪的实现解析

    指标:记录和呈现可聚合的数据。 追踪:单个请求的一系列事件。...计时 计时在追踪中是高频操作,每个 Span 都需要取两次时间戳,分别代表事件的起始和结束时刻,因此计时的性能会很大程度上影响追踪的性能。...Rust 社区也提供了库 coarsetime 获取 Coarse Time: coarsetime::Instant::now() Coarse Time 性能很高,在测试环境下完成两次调用仅需要 10ns...[up-5d3122c1143d9a1d9d8f57718d0806e0634.png] 在追踪中,完整的计时操作会读取两次时间戳,分别代表事件的始末。...通过上述方式为单个函数记录的执行信息如下: 调用的发生时刻 调用的返回时刻 直接(或间接)调用者的引用 直接(或间接)调用的子函数的引用 例如,追踪两个同步函数 foo 和 bar,通过添加 trace

    92520

    Redis AOF 持久化详解

    文件写入和同步 Redis 每次结束一个事件循环之前,它都会调用 flushAppendOnlyFile 函数,判断是否需要将 AOF 缓存区中的内容写入和同步到 AOF 文件中。...当发生故障停机时,AOF 持久化也只会丢失一个事件循环中所产生的命令数据。...同步文件之前,如果此时系统故障宕机,缓冲区内数据将丢失。 而 fsync 针对单个文件操作,对其进行强制硬盘同步,fsync 将阻塞直到写入磁盘完成后返回,保证了数据持久化。...appendfsync的三个值代表着三种不同的调用 fsync的策略。调用fsync周期越频繁,读写效率就越差,但是相应的安全性越高,发生宕机时丢失的数据越少。...[示意图] 如上图所示,重写前要记录名为list的键的状态,AOF 文件要保存五条命令,而重写后,则只需要保存一条命令。

    82100

    GFS — 取舍的艺术

    后者以库代码形式提供,为前者调用。每次进行文件操作,Client 会首先向 Master 询问文件元信息,然后依据获取的数据位置信息去相应的 Chunkserver 找对应数据。...不同于普通的写入操作,需要指定偏移量和数据,记录追加操作只需要指定数据,在写成功后,写成功的记录偏移量将会返回给客户端。...但是对于记录追加操作,系统会通过以下手段来保证写入的数据的原子性(即单个记录内容只来自一个客户端)和可靠性: 如果遇到多客户端并发,由系统统一安排追加顺序,并且单个记录追加时不会被中断。...设置此标志位后,Linux 的系统调用保证移动到文件末尾并且进行数据追加是一个原子调用。而对于记录追加操作,GFS 也提供了类似的原子性保证。...当然,如何记录合适的日志事件也需要一些经验和技巧。GFS 会对一些机器关键性(块服务器的上下线)的事件,所有的 RPC 请求和回应等等,在空间允许的情况下,GFS 会尽可能多的保留系统日志。

    1.1K20

    一文搞懂什么是阻塞IO、信号驱动IO、Reactor模型、零拷贝

    数据传输方式或者说是运输方式角度看,可以将 IO 类分为: 字节流, 字节流读取单个字节,字符流读取单个字符(一个字符根据编码的不同,对应的字节也不同,如 UTF-8 编码中文汉字是 3 个字节,GBK...之后再使用 recvfrom 把数据从内核复制到进程中。 它可以让单个进程具有处理多个 I/O 事件的能力。又被称为 Event Driven I/O,即事件驱动 I/O。 有哪些多路复用IO?...Selector(选择区)用于监听多个通道的事件(比如:连接打开,数据到达)。因此,单个线程可以监听多个数据通道。...首先,期间共发生了 4 次用户态与内核态的上下文切换,因为发生了两次系统调用,一次是 read() ,一次是 write(),每次系统调用都得先从用户态切换到内核态,等内核完成任务后,再从内核态切换回用户态...其次,还发生了 4 次数据拷贝,其中两次是 DMA 的拷贝,另外两次则是通过 CPU 拷贝的,下面说一下这个过程: 第一次拷贝,把磁盘上的数据拷贝到操作系统内核的缓冲区里,这个拷贝的过程是通过 DMA

    34610

    ERPLAB中文教程:创建与查看EventList

    EEGLAB将一组脑电图数据存储在数据集中。数据集通常存储来自单个受试者的数据,可以是单个试验块,要么是整个会话。数据集保存在EEGLAB的内存中,也可以保存在磁盘上。...事件代码(此处代码并非程序代码,可以理解为编码)嵌入在EEGLAB的EEG结构内的数据集中。...在内部,ERPLAB将其存储为EVENTLIST结构(作为EEG.EVENTLIST追加到EEG结构中)。但是EventList也可以保存在文本文件中,在该文件中可以轻松查看和操作事件信息。...如上图,加载了F3、F4等通道信息,同时还有眼电伪迹[包括水平眼电HEOG和垂直眼电VEOG] 单击>>按钮两次,以向前滚动时间。...(可能会弹出警告,警告您所有事件中的某些都包含基于事件事件标签,而不是数字事件代码。现在,忽略它并单击Continue按钮)。

    2.3K10

    sqlplus基础命令

    在sqlplus_里面考虑到了以后有可能要调用本机的操作系统程序,所以提供有直接系统命令的调用操作 6....总结 Oracle安装完成后,但是如果要想进行数据库的使用,那么就必须依靠一些工具完成,Oracle提供有sqlplus命令,可以直接通过命令行窗口打开它,只需要输入:sqlplus 输入用户名和密码...切换使用的用户: conn用户名[/密码][AS SYSDBA]; 如果使用超级管理员登录则必须追加 AS SYSDBA; 切换到system账户: conn system/manager; ?...清屏快捷键:clear scr 所以在sqlplus里面提供有两个操作指令: 设置每行显示的数据长度:set linesize 每行长度; ? 设置完发现 列名 出现了两次。...这个时候就需要设置每页的长度了 设置每页显示的数据长度: set pagesize 每页长度; 设置好后就没有出现两次 列名 的情况了,也就每页分页的情况了 ? 4.

    94820
    领券